What to look for in a Glasgow solicitor
Law Society of Scotland regulation. All solicitors practising in Scotland must be regulated by the Law Society of Scotland — not the SRA, which regulates solicitors in England and Wales only. Check the Law Society of Scotland's publicly searchable register before instructing any solicitor in Glasgow. This is the fundamental, non-negotiable starting point.
Scots law specialism in your area of need. Scots law differs from English law in significant and practically important ways. Residential conveyancing in Scotland proceeds through a system of missives — a series of formal letters exchanged between solicitors that constitute a binding contract — which is entirely different from the English exchange/completion model. Scots law of evidence, delict (rather than tort), and the Sheriff Court/Court of Session structure all have no direct English equivalents. Instructing a solicitor who genuinely practises Scots law — rather than one primarily trained in English law making occasional forays into Scottish matters — is essential.
Commercial property expertise for Glasgow's regeneration. The Merchant City and Finnieston are among the UK's most active commercial regeneration zones. Glasgow solicitors experienced in Scottish commercial property transactions — taking title on the Sasines or Land Register, negotiating commercial leases under Scots law, and dealing with the Scottish Planning system — will handle these matters far more efficiently than those without specific Scottish commercial property experience.
Faculty of Advocates and Court of Session awareness. For complex litigation, judicial review, and appeals, cases may progress to the Court of Session in Edinburgh or involve counsel from the Faculty of Advocates. Glasgow solicitors who regularly instruct Advocates and who understand the Court of Session procedure will navigate contentious matters more effectively.
